Landlord’s Insurance


“It feels so unjust. You own a property, you let it to someone on the promise of a fair rent, and they don’t pay up. More often than not, you will have a mortgage to pay, and the lender expects its monthly instalments. It feels like the property owner takes all the risks. Surely my insurance broker will be able to find a way to mitigate the risk of arrears with insurance.”

This is a common plea, and help is at hand. Rent Guarantee Insurance helps to redress the balance in favour of the property owner. In addition to replacing your lost income, the insurance company will bring all of its experience and organisational skills into securing the eviction of the errant tenant.

Since the recession hit and more and more people have been struggling to afford rent, this type of insurance has risen greatly in popularity. There are many reasons that people let themselves get into arrears with rent, they could be one half of a divorced couple struggling on their own, or a trades-person without much work, but either way the vast majority of people do not intend to get into arrears when they take on the property, however landlords do have a right to collect rent.

In most cases, the landlords actually need the rent payments to keep up their payments on the mortgage. With the rise in “buy to let” mortgages landlords are quite often just regular people with mortgage payments to meet, and if they get behind on them then their property could be repossessed, and so that’s why a lot of them are willing to pay out a little bit more for the insurance to cover them against failed rent payments.

There are two key facets of the insurance taken out. First, property owners insure against the lost income from their tenants going into arrears. For a premium, the insurance company will pay the rent if the tenant does not. Some insurers will ask for credit checks to be performed, some will not. Some will insure you even if the tenant is claiming benefits, but many won’t, so take care to buy the right policy.

Secondly, the insurance company will often help you to secure an eviction if your tenant simply can’t keep up. This is very helpful, and you should make sure you have this cover with your insurances. Most landlords do not have the time or the skills to succeed in this minefield. The Importance Of Having Caravan Insurance

A man called Chester Cooke was once very excited about an idea he had. He wanted to buy a caravan on the banks of the river Avon on a well-kept, professionally owned and run caravan site with plenty of amenities. However, not being the sort of chap that would buy something like a caravan on impulse, he looked into everything that could possibly go wrong, all the hidden costs and anything that could potentially cost him over and above what he was willing to pay.

Chester then called his broker and explained to him that he was looking for some caravan insurance. His broker then told him that he would be more than happy to find him a quote, and so Chester gave him the details of the caravan such as the size, type and value, as well was where it would be situated.

It was only a few minutes before the broker called him back and said that he unfortunately could not find him any caravan insurance. The reason was that although the caravan site itself was fine, it was the particular spot that Chester wanted that was the problem. It was next to the river Avon, right at the water’s edge, and last year it had flooded which caused lots of insurance claims, meaning that now, insurers are unwilling to offer any insurance to caravans places right on the water’s edge. If he was going to buy the caravan, it was going to be entirely at his own risk.

This news meant that Chester could not have his caravan exactly where he wanted because it was quite likely that the Avon would flood again at some point in time and he could not afford to have a caravan there without it being insured. He asked his broker about other “normal criteria” for caravan insurance so that might continue pursuing his plans to buy a caravan.

In terms of insurance, the ideal caravan site should be a registered CaSSOA site, this is because these sites have security standards that all caravans must meet. If the caravan is to be placed less formally, for example, on a farm, then the caravan should have its own compound with a defined perimeter. Some insurance providers insist that a caravan site has a minimum number of caravans. A sort of, “safety in numbers” logic. Another thing to look for in a caravan site is a defined boundary that is secure and would not allow uninvited people to come and go as they please.

Before this, Chester hadn’t really given much though to caravan insurance. He didn’t think it was going to be such a big part his decision to buy a caravan. All he knew was that he was grateful to have a good broker who knew how to take care of it all because after all, all he really wanted to do was enjoy his caravan. The insurance was just to take the worry out of owning it.

Caravan insurance is one of the biggest factors to take into consideration when thinking about buying a caravan. Trial And Error:Overcoming Low Self Esteem

You should know that overcoming low self esteem issues are difficult. Even though it’s a common problem, people deal with it differently. The question isn’t necessarily whether or not you deal with it, but of how you deal with it. Some people take a bad day and make it worse and others use it to improve themselves. The later is the type of person we want you to be.

You should try and observe what types of people are around you. There are many dynamics people have with their friends. Some people are very loving while other relationships are based on making jokes. In this scenario, the way you have a good time is by saying mean (joking) things to one another.

You should know that this is not a healthy relationship to be in. This is because if someone calls you fat, even if they take it back, in the back of your mind you will wonder why they used your weight instead of something else. When you are surrounded by this it will make you really insecure. You should stop this by either telling the person to stop, or distancing yourself from them. You should also write down some of the negative things they say.

There are other types of unhealthy relationships, like when your friend constantly points out a flaw you may have. You should know that everyone has flaws, but the fact that someone keeps reminding you of the fact makes you insecure about it, even up to an unhealthy level. You should write down everything they say to you so that you can remember it for the next step.

The next thing you have to do is address all of the things they have said. How do you feel about them? Do you want to change them? If you can’t change them how will you accept it?

The next thing you should know is that cosmetic procedures may fix the exterior but it’s difficult for them to fix the issues you have with your self esteem. If you get liposuction, you don’t walk out of the room feeling more confident. You may feel it for a while, but then you will feel insecure about something else. Learning to deal with it is a process.
